
darknet
>LWL<
这个作者很懒,什么都没留下…
展开
专栏收录文章
- 默认排序
- 最新发布
- 最早发布
- 最多阅读
- 最少阅读
-
无法解析的外部符号 __cudaPushCallConfiguration
最近在编译YOLOv3的darknet时,VS2015报错显示无法解析的外部符号__cudaPushCallConfiguration,系统是Win10。但是CUDA9.2以及CUDNN都是完好的。问题出在哪呢?最近电脑安装了很多版本的CUDACUDA版本CUDNNCUDA9.0CUDNNCUDA9.2CUDNNCUDA10.0CUDNNCUDA10.2CUDNN问题出在环境变量的顺序1.修改CUDA_PATH环境变量为CUDA9.2路径,不起作用2原创 2020-06-29 18:30:28 · 3150 阅读 · 0 评论 -
YOLO官方分类权重下载
darknet53.weights不等于darknet53.conv.74首先darknet53.weights是darknet53这个分类网络的权重;darknet53.conv.74是YOLOv3的主干网络的权重,YOLOv3的主干网络改进自(不等于)darknet53,所以darknet53.weights不等于darknet53.conv.74 首先darknet53.weights是darknet53这个分类网络的权重;darknet53.conv.74。原因是主干网络阉掉了部分层。下载地址呢原创 2020-06-28 21:48:51 · 4119 阅读 · 0 评论 -
VOC格式数据集运行k-means算法
1.将所有xml文件放到k-means项目的Annotations文件夹下2.在Annotations同级目录下运行C:\Windows\System32\cmd.exe打开cmd窗口3.运行python example.py得到结果原创 2020-03-12 17:16:13 · 1303 阅读 · 0 评论 -
Yolo3 darknet voc格式数据集制作训练经验
数据集中有两张图像属于同一类物体但是Scale尺度差异太大(就是图像大小一致,但图像中的物体一个特别大,另一个特别小),会导致系统崩溃。解决办法也很简单,在中间插入无关的一个类别作为分界线,而且最好插入2张以上。...原创 2020-01-04 18:03:43 · 773 阅读 · 1 评论 -
VS2015 生成darknet接口类动态库dll时无法生成对应的lib
没有__declspec(dllexport) 就不会生成dll对应的lib解决方法:将接口类定义为导出模式,关键字__declspec(dllexport)class __declspec(dllexport) darknet:public Detector即可生成对应的lib库,如下图问题二:如果不添加关键字__declspec(dllexport)的话,只生成dll,则引用该d...原创 2019-12-09 13:30:33 · 989 阅读 · 0 评论 -
YOLOv3 darknet Windows版 评价指标的命令行
处理data/train.txt中一列表的图像 , 并将保存检测的结果到 result.json文件 使用: darknet.exe detector test cfg/coco.data cfg/yolov3.cfg yolov3.weights -ext_output -dont_show -out result.json < data/train.txt处理data/train....原创 2019-12-08 13:01:42 · 860 阅读 · 0 评论 -
darknet检测与初始化分离
1.class Detector数据成员private: std::shared_ptr<void> detector_gpu_ptr;//智能指针 std::deque<std::vector<bbox_t>> prev_bbox_vec_deque;//deque(双端队列)是由一段一段的定量连续空间构成,可以向两端发展,因此不论在尾...原创 2019-12-02 15:05:50 · 1135 阅读 · 0 评论 -
YOLO3网络层具体参数的输出位置
1.卷积层的输出0 conv 32 3 x 3/ 1 416 x 416 x 3 -> 416 x 416 x 32 0.299 BF输出位置:darknet-master\src\convolutional_layer.c(564): fprintf(stderr, "%4d x%4d x%4d -> %4d x%4d x%4d %5....原创 2019-11-29 11:53:54 · 1984 阅读 · 0 评论 -
YOLOv3的IoU与众不同???
普通IoU:计算在x轴上的重叠长度给定:X1,W1 X2,W2min(X1+W1,X2+W2)-max(X1,X2)YOLO:计算在x轴上的重叠长度给定:X1,W1 X2,W2min(X1+W1/2,X2+W2/2)-max(X1-W1/2,X2-W2/2)原创 2019-10-19 18:32:10 · 912 阅读 · 2 评论 -
YOLO3检测调用函数流程plus获取网络中间输出结果
void run_detector(int argc, char **argv)void test_detector(char *datacfg, char *cfgfile, char *weightfile, char *filename, float thresh, float hier_thresh, int dont_show, int ext_output, int save_la...原创 2019-09-11 12:34:28 · 993 阅读 · 0 评论 -
YOLO源码(结构体)解读
原文出处1. src/network.h(darknet中网络结构体:network)typedef struct network { int n; // 网络总层数 int batch; uint64_t *seen; // 目前已经读入的图片张数(网络已经处理的图片张数)(在make_network()中动态分配内存) int *t; float...原创 2019-09-04 12:01:49 · 1270 阅读 · 0 评论 -
安装darknet时遇到的报错
报错代码jack@jack-System-Product-Name:~$ cd darknet-masterjack@jack-System-Product-Name:~/darknet-master$ make -j16gcc -Iinclude/ -Isrc/ -Wall -Wno-unused-result -Wno-unknown-pragmas -Wfatal-errors -fP...原创 2018-10-08 17:21:02 · 8480 阅读 · 7 评论 -
darknet makefile文件修改 适配opencv3.2.0 + CUDA9.0 + cudnn9.0
第一步GPU=1CUDNN=1OPENCV=1有英伟达显卡的GPU=1安装了cudnn的改为CUDNN=1安装了opencv的改为OPENCV=1如果没有安装对应的,不需要修改第二步(makefile文件往下翻,配置cuda路径)NVCC=/usr/local/cuda-9.0/bin/nvcc注意此处的cuda-9.0要改为自己配置的cuda版本,如cuda-9.1,cud...原创 2018-10-22 19:34:40 · 3089 阅读 · 2 评论 -
darknet环境安装顺序
nvidia驱动opencvcudacudnndarknet训练原创 2019-02-25 15:26:44 · 787 阅读 · 0 评论 -
darknet数据集VOC制作
background系统:ubantu18.4机器:HP-Z840-Workstation处理器:Intel® Xeon® CPU E5-2660 v3 @ 2.60GHz × 40显卡:Quadro K5200/PCIe/SSE2opencv 3.3.0cuda 9.0cudnn 7.0(在本机器上未连接好)数据集文件布局VOCdevkit ——VOC2018 ...原创 2019-03-14 19:42:22 · 1444 阅读 · 0 评论 -
YOLO3 Windows10配置教程
硬件环境1.操作系统 Windows 10 64位 ( DirectX 12 )2.处理器 AMD Ryzen 5 2600X 六核3.显卡 Nvidia GeForce GTX 1070 Ti ( 8 GB / 索泰 )软件环境1.Opencv 3.2.02.CUDA 9.2.1483.Cudnn 7.13.YOLO3 Windows版4.VS2017 企业版配置流程1.修...原创 2019-07-28 12:30:29 · 1220 阅读 · 0 评论 -
YOLO3 Windows训练自己的数据集
下载VOCdevkit置于darknet-master\build\darknet\x64目录下1.xml放Annotations img放JPEGImages2.cd到VOCdevkit\VOC2007 运行python test.py3.cd到VOCdevkit同一目录下 运行python voc_label.py 修改voc_label.py中类的名字4.将VOCdevkit同...原创 2019-08-13 12:44:58 · 1104 阅读 · 0 评论 -
labelimg win10安装教程
anaconda下载1.路径不能有中文2.选择all users3.选择add path打开cmd界面,cd到labelimg源码内,输入以下命令行conda install pyqt=5pyrcc5 -o libs/resources.py resources.qrcpython labelImg.pypython labelImg.py [IMAGE_PATH] [PRE-DE...原创 2019-08-06 16:43:16 · 1171 阅读 · 0 评论 -
YOLO-darknet-Windows新建工程遇到的问题以及解决办法
在新建工程下添加以下文件模型相关:obj.namesyolo-obj.cfgyolo-obj_final.weightsOpencv库文件:opencv_world320.dllopencv_world320d.dlldarknet-master\build\darknet\x64路径下的:pthreadGC2.dllpthreadVC2.dll编译yolo_cpp_dl...原创 2019-08-29 21:14:18 · 2333 阅读 · 0 评论 -
darkne可视化网络层(卷继层)源码解读(寻码溯源)
可视化语句darknet.exe visualize cfg/yolo-obj.cfg .\backup\yolo-obj_last.weights调用函数一:可视化cfg和weightC:darknet-master\src\darknet.cvoid visualize(char *cfgfile, char *weightfile){ network net...原创 2019-09-02 14:39:44 · 818 阅读 · 1 评论 -
Ubantu18.4 + Cuda9.0+ Nvidia geforce 1070Ti安装教程网站资源索引 亲测有效
英伟达驱动安装https://linuxconfig.org/how-to-install-the-nvidia-drivers-on-ubuntu-18-04-bionic-beaver-linuxcuda9.0安装安装包下载(下载全部,包括补丁)https://blog.youkuaiyun.com/u010801439/article/details/80483036环境配置(使...转载 2018-10-12 12:35:43 · 737 阅读 · 0 评论